Output f51882b629886688a02bdb691829412001ae93b25a366d2c567c95a3e8d6308e:1

value
668517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5493fd3eb6e0746eba1a779b8f5ede97d02f2592 OP_EQUAL
address
39QDy8ViYxyu3ejCm8d2VLNAj2ebHKASjB
transaction
f51882b629886688a02bdb691829412001ae93b25a366d2c567c95a3e8d6308e
spent
true